What does one mean by a Registered Agent?
A representative is a specific person or commercial entity which takes care of receiving important official documents on behalf of a company. This includes documents such as lawsuits, tax documents, and official government correspondence. By having a registered agent, a company ensures that it has a reliable contact person for concerns that require prompt attention, aiding to support compliance with local regulations.
In the state of Washington, having a registered agent is a lawful requirement for all business entities, including business corporations and LLCs. The agent must be located in the state and be accessible during standard business hours to handle documents. This arrangement ensures that the entity will not miss key notifications, which could bring about legal consequences if not attended to.

Frequent FAQs About Registered Agents in Washington
One frequent inquiry regarding registered agent services within Washington is whether a entrepreneur can serve as his/her own registered agent. Yes, in the State of Washington, individuals can serve as one's own registered agent if they have a physical address within the state. However, it is advised to engage a professional registered agent service for improved confidentiality and to make certain adherence with regulatory requirements.
Another often asked question is concerning the duties of a registered agent in Washington. A designated agent is charged with receiving critical legal documents, including legal notices, government correspondence, and compliance notices on the behalf of the enterprise. more info here is essential as it ensures that the business can be contacted for all legal matters swiftly and efficiently.
Lastly, many ask about the expenses related to hiring a registered agent within Washington. Rates can differ based on the provider, but typically range from 100 to three hundred annually. It is crucial for new businesses to consider these expenses as part of their complete budget, because having a reliable registered agent can assist avoid legal problems and ensure good standing with the state.
